Returns the noise for a given x and y value with multiple octaves applied. * @param x A floating point value. * @param y A floating point value. * @param octaves An integer value between 1 and 8. Each octave is a layer of progressively smaller noise that is applied to the final result. * @param persistence A decimal value between 0.05 and 0.95. Larger values will cause each octave to have a larger impact on the final result. @return A decimal value between 0 and 1. */ ConsoleMethodWithDocs(NoiseGenerator, getComplexNoise, ConsoleFloat, 6, 6, (float x, float y, int octaves, float persistence)) { if (argc < 6) { Con::warnf("NoiseGenerator::getComplexNoise() - Invalid number of parameters!"); return 0.0f; } else { return object->getComplexNoise(dAtof(argv[2]), dAtof(argv[3]), dAtoi(argv[4]), dAtof(argv[5])); } } ConsoleMethodGroupEndWithDocs(NoiseGenerator)
